Look for some … WebMar 23, 2024 · Fill the pots a quarter-inch to the top with this mixture, and then poke a hole in the center of each pot with a chopstick or pencil. Lower a cutting into place so that half of the stem is covered by soil. Firm up the medium around it and water thoroughly. Grape vine propagation technique in which a cane of a desirable parent is cut off and rooted. This cane is typically grafted to a suitable rootstock. The resulting vine is an exact copy of the parent.
